This week marks an important milestone. Saturday is the 10th anniversary of the birth of BBM, and it has left many of us reflecting on how far we’ve come. What started as a simple PIN-to-PIN, text-only, BlackBerry smartphone instant messaging solution has become a thriving, cross-platform global social network with text, visual and animated messages, money transfer options, secure video meetings, and an incredibly engaged community.
As part of the week-long celebration, we’ve asked the team about their favorite milestones and moments. Here are some of the most impactful events in BBM history:
- August 1, 2005: Birth of BlackBerry Messenger
- August 2009:
- GPS location integrated with BBM
- BBM adds PIN barcode scanning
- Introduced Streamlined voice notes and Animated Display Picture first on mobile device
- July 28, 2011: BBM 6 Launches with Connected Apps
- November 2, 2011: BBM Music Beta Launches
- September 13, 2012: BBM Enters the Collins English Dictionary
- December 10, 2012: BBM Voice Launches with BBM7 Update
- October 22, 2013: BBM Goes Cross Platform
- November 26, 2013: BBM Channels Launches
- April 1, 2014: BBM Stickers Launches
- November 20, 2014: BBM Meetings Launches
- January 7, 2015: BBM Supports Android Wearables
- February, 2015: BBM Shop Hits 1 Billion Views
- March 4, 2015: BBM Hits 100M Google Play Installs
- June 26, 2015: Private Chat Introduced
- July 3, 2015: BBM Gets Android Material Design Makeover
- August 1, 2015: BBM Celebrates its 10th Birthday
